Four Arkansans are facing federal counterfeiting charges for allegedly purchasing nearly $4,000 worth of electronics at a North Little Rock Target.
Cameko Cogshell, Tia Ferguson, Maisha Land and Dana McCoy were all arrested last Thursday for conspiracy to pass counterfeit money.
According to the arrest affidavit, the four suspects made seven purchases in just two weeks at the Target located at 4000 McCain Boulevard.
The U.S. Secret Service is still investigating the incidents. They say the suspects undoubtedly made additional purchases with the counterfeit money.
